ARK Invest Reshuffles Portfolio: $71.5M Amazon (AMZN) Buy, $65.8M AMD Exit

Key Highlights

  • ARK Invest acquired 280,450 shares of Amazon valued at approximately $71.5 million on April 24, 2026
  • The firm divested 215,643 AMD shares valued at roughly $65.8 million during the same trading session
  • Amazon shares have climbed 15% year-to-date, touching a record peak of $263.99 on April 24
  • AMD has surged 62% in 2026; shares jumped 14% following positive Intel quarterly results
  • Amazon’s Q1 FY26 earnings are scheduled for April 29; AMD reports on May 5

Cathie Wood’s strategic direction is becoming increasingly evident. ARK Invest has systematically expanded its Amazon holdings while simultaneously trimming its AMD position — and the trades executed last Friday underscore this strategic realignment.

On April 24, ARK acquired 280,450 Amazon (AMZN) shares distributed across its exchange-traded funds, representing approximately $71.5 million in capital deployment. This marked the firm’s second Amazon accumulation that week, coming after a modest 3,492-share acquisition earlier.

During the identical trading day, ARK divested 215,643 AMD (AMD) shares, generating approximately $65.8 million in proceeds. This disposal follows a previous AMD transaction where the firm sold roughly 44,446 shares earlier this month.

These coordinated transactions signal a calculated reallocation — moving away from semiconductor manufacturing exposure toward what Wood perceives as the more comprehensive AI infrastructure opportunity.

Amazon’s share price has rallied over 15% since the start of the year, hitting an unprecedented high of $263.99 on April 24. The strategic timing of ARK’s accumulation is particularly significant. Amazon is slated to release Q1 FY26 financial results on April 29, following the closing bell.

Analyst consensus anticipates Amazon delivering earnings per share of $1.63, representing a 2.5% year-over-year increase. Top-line revenue is projected to expand approximately 14% to $177.27 billion.

Anticipation Builds for Amazon’s Quarterly Report

Prior to the earnings announcement, Cantor Fitzgerald’s Deepak Mathivanan elevated his Amazon valuation target to $280 from the previous $260, maintaining an Overweight stance. His analysis highlighted robust AWS expansion fueled by artificial intelligence requirements, with contract backlog expanding from partnerships with OpenAI and Anthropic. He also noted elevated operational expenses as a potential short-term headwind.

Amazon commands a Strong Buy rating from the investment community, supported by 42 Buy recommendations and three Hold ratings. The consensus price objective stands at $287.33, suggesting approximately 8.8% appreciation potential from present trading levels.

Amazon’s GF Score registers at 94 out of 100, featuring a flawless 10/10 growth classification. The company trades at a P/E multiple of 36.82x. One noteworthy consideration: company insiders have liquidated approximately $28 million in shares during the previous three-month period, with zero insider acquisitions documented during that timeframe.

AMD’s Remarkable Performance

AMD has delivered impressive returns. The semiconductor stock has appreciated 62% year-to-date, propelled by artificial intelligence processor demand and data center expansion.

Friday’s remarkable 14% intraday rally followed Intel’s stronger-than-anticipated Q1 performance, elevating optimism throughout the semiconductor sector. This upward momentum may have provided Wood with an opportune moment to realize gains ahead of AMD’s earnings disclosure on May 5.

D.A. Davidson’s Gil Luria elevated AMD to Buy from Hold, emphasizing structural expansion in processor demand and enhanced clarity regarding data center operations. He referenced Intel’s Q1 performance as an indicator of potential upside for AMD’s upcoming financial disclosure.

The Street anticipates AMD will deliver Q1 EPS of $1.28, reflecting 32% year-over-year growth, alongside revenue of $9.87 billion — representing a 33% annual increase.

AMD maintains a Moderate Buy consensus rating, comprising 20 Buy recommendations and seven Hold ratings. The average valuation target of $295.04 suggests approximately 15% downside from prevailing price levels.

ARK executed additional portfolio adjustments on April 24, purchasing 4,020,925 shares of X-Energy Inc (XE) valued at $92.5 million, while liquidating holdings in Rocket Lab (RKLB), Teradyne (TER), Caterpillar (CAT), and Iridium Communications (IRDM).
